Tailoring the Perfect Gesture for Any Recipient

One of the biggest challenges in gift-giving is knowing what someone actually wants. Do they prefer bold, bright items or muted, natural tones? Are they into cooking and wine, or are they more focused on self-care? This dilemma often leads to generic, underwhelming gifts.

A hamper allows you to narrow down the focus instantly. You can create hyper-specific themes:

  • The "Bookworm" Hamper: Includes gourmet tea, reading socks, a bookmark, and high-quality cocoa mix.
  • The "Wellness Warrior" Hamper: Features essential oils, bath salts, a linen face mask, and herbal remedies.
  • The "Coffee Connoisseur" Hamper: Pairs single-origin beans with custom mugs and biscotti.
